Using this for the evernote-account-plugin.apparmor:
{
    "template": "ubuntu-account-plugin",
    "policy_groups": [
        "accounts",
        "audio",
        "networking",
        "webview"
    ],
    "policy_version": 1.2
}

with apparmor-easyprof-ubuntu 1.3.4 (pending upload), I can successfully create 
an account under confinement. The reminders app itself is unable to use the 
account (I can start it, but it never leaves the splash screen). There are some 
denials:
...
Feb  3 21:37:50 ubuntu-phablet kernel: [ 5634.484968] type=1400 
audit(1422999470.948:429): apparmor="DENIED" operation="mknod" 
profile="com.ubuntu.reminders_evernote-account-plugin_0.5.latest" 
name="/tmp/etilqs_R5PWXVRkWjQcVBC" pid=10898 comm="BrowserBlocking" 
requested_mask="c" denied_mask="c" fsuid=32011 ouid=32011
